Poste Italiane could exceed year-end growth targets

The chief executive of Italian postal operator Poste Italiane, Massimo Sarmi, said yesterday that the group could also exceed its 2005 targets. Poste’s half-year results, to be released on October 3, indicate a growth trend, he said.

Mr Sarmi confirmed the group’s target of annual revenue growth of 3.5 per cent in 2006-2008, accompanied by 5 per cent annual growth in EBITDA and 10 per cent in operating profit. The group also announced a five-year contract to provide correspondence managemet to Italy’s financial police force.
